Obi, Kwankwaso Formally Join NDC
Former presidential candidates Peter Obi and Rabiu Musa Kwankwaso have formally joined the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C), marking a major political realignment ahead of the 2027 general elections.
The two opposition figures were officially received on Sunday in Abuja by NDC leaders, including former Bayelsa State governor Seriake Dickson and the partyâs national chairman, Senator Cleopas Moses Zuwoghe.
Their defection follows weeks of speculation over their political future amid internal crises within the African Democratic Congress (ADC). Reports indicate that Obi recently resigned from the ADC, citing a toxic political environment and unresolved leadership disputes.
Speaking after the closed-door meeting, Kwankwaso urged Nigerians to support the NDC, while party leaders described both politicians as strategic additions capable of strengthening the opposition coalition ahead of 2027.
Political observers believe the move could reshape Nigeriaâs opposition landscape, with Obi commanding strong support among young voters and Kwankwaso maintaining significant influence in Northern Nigeria through the Kwankwasiyya movement.
The development is already generating nationwide reactions as analysts predict new alliances, possible mergers, and intensified political calculations ahead of the next presidential election.
